I have a spreadsheet which was created in xl03. Within this spreadsheet there are comments in cells (right mouse click on a cell and add comments - then the red indicator sits within the cell to let you know there is a comment there.
Now I am using xl07 and I cant see any of the red indicators, although when I right mouse click, I can edit the comment. Is there a way that you can "turn on" the red indicators in xl07?

Click on the Office Button
Click on Excel Options
Click on Advanced
Scroll down to Display
Under For Cells with Comments, show:
Select Indicators only and comments on hover
Click OK
